United States

Popularity of the name NECHELLE since 1880.

Number of births per year since 1880.

Statistics for the given name Nechelle in the United States are quite interesting to analyze over time. From 1967 to 2000, there were a total of 295 babies named Nechelle born in the U.S.

Looking at the year-by-year data, we can observe that the name's popularity fluctuated throughout these years:

* The name Nechelle peaked in popularity between 1987 and 1994, with more than 10 births each year during this period. * The highest number of babies named Nechelle was born in 1993, with a total of 14 births that year. * After the mid-1990s, the popularity of the name Nechelle began to decline. From 1996 onwards, fewer than 10 babies were named Nechelle each year, with some years even seeing less than 5 births.
